Stand-up comedian and Middle TN native Nate Bargatze will host the 77th annual Emmy Awards, airing live from the Peacock Theater in Los Angeles on September 14. “It’s a huge honor to be asked to host such an iconic awards show and I’m beyond excited to work with CBS to create a night that can be enjoyed by families around the world,” said Bargatze. This isn’t his first time working with CBS; he previously hosted Nate Bargatze’s Nashville Christmas last year. He’s one of the top stand-up comedians working today. In 2024, he sold over 1.2 million tickets, earning him the title of the highest-earning comedian globally. Nominations for the 2025 Emmy Awards will be revealed on July 15th. (Variety)
